How to Make stir fry sauce
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ious stir fry sauce:
Step 1: Gather Your Ingredients
First things first—get all your ingredients ready. Measure out soy sauce, sesame oil, fresh ginger, minced garlic, honey (or brown sugar), rice vinegar, and cornstarch. Having everything at hand will make your cooking experience smooth like butter!
Step 2: Mix It Up
In a medium bowl, whisk together soy sauce, sesame oil, grated ginger, minced garlic, and honey (or brown sugar). Let those flavors mingle like old friends at a reunion; they need time to get cozy.
Step 3: Add Some Tang
Pour in the rice vinegar and give it another good mix. This step is crucial—it’s like adding a splash of sunshine to brighten everything up!
Step 4: Thicken It Up
In a small bowl, combine cornstarch with an equal part of cold water until smooth. Then slowly whisk this mixture into your flavorful concoction while heating it on medium-low heat. Watch as it transforms into a glossy masterpiece!
Step 5: Taste Test Time
Once thickened (about one minute), take it off the heat and do the most important step—taste! Adjust sweetness or saltiness as needed; after all, you’re the boss here!

Add Your Touch to stir fry sauce
Feel free to get creative with your stir fry sauce! Swap soy sauce for tamari for a gluten-free option or add some peanut butter for a creamy twist. Toss in fresh herbs or chili flakes to enhance the flavor profile.
Storing & Reheating stir fry sauce
Store any leftover stir fry sauce in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week. When reheating, do so gently over low heat to maintain the flavors without burning the sauce.

How do you make homemade stir fry sauce?
To create your own stir fry sauce, combine equal parts soy sauce and rice vinegar for a tangy base. Add a tablespoon of cornstarch for thickness and some water to reach your desired consistency. For flavor, mix in minced garlic, fresh ginger, and a pinch of sugar. You can also customize it by adding sesame oil or chili paste for an extra kick. This homemade version allows you to adjust the flavors to suit your palate perfectly.

Stir Fry Sauce
Stir fry sauce is your secret weapon for transforming everyday meals into flavorful feasts. This quick and easy homemade sauce combines sweet, savory, and umami notes, making it perfect for tossing with vibrant veggies, succulent proteins, or even drizzling over rice. In just minutes, you can whip up this versatile sauce that will elevate any dish and leave your guests asking for more.
- Total Time: 10 minutes
- Yield: About 8 servings 1x
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up low-sodium soy sauce
- 2 tbsp sesame oil
- 1 tbsp fresh ginger, grated
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tbsp honey or brown sugar
- 2 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tbsp cornstarch mixed with 2 tbsp cold water
Instructions
- Gather all ingredients and measure them out.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together soy sauce, sesame oil, ginger, garlic, and honey or brown sugar until well combined.
- Add the rice vinegar and mix thoroughly.
- In a separate small bowl, combine cornstarch with cold water until smooth. Gradually whisk this mixture into the sauce while heating over medium-low heat.
- Cook until thickened (about one minute), then remove from heat and taste to adjust flavors if needed.
- Serve immediately over your favorite stir-fry or store in an airtight container for later use.
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Category: Sauce
- Method: Mixing
- Cuisine: Asian
